What to do in Mar Lodj, Senegal
Mar Lodj is a small island located in the Sine Saloum Delta region of Senegal, which is surrounded by the Saloum River and the Atlantic Ocean. The island has a unique atmosphere with its lush and verdant surrounding, and peaceful surroundings which offer tourists an ideal getaway from the busy city life. Mar Lodj is a popular destination for adventurous travelers and nature lovers who want to explore its fantastic flora and fauna while enjoying the hospitality of the locals. Here are our top picks for the best tourist attractions in Mar Lodj.
1. Traditional Fishing Villages
The island is well known for its traditional fishing villages, which are home to some of the friendliest people in Senegal. The inhabitants rely on fishing for their livelihood, and tourists can experience their daily activities, such as boat trips to catch fish or visit a traditional fishing market to see and buy fresh seafood.
2. Mangrove Forest Reserve
Mar Lodj is surrounded by a large mangrove forest, which is home to various wildlife such as monkeys, birds, and reptiles. Tourists can take a boat ride or a walking tour through the mangrove forest to learn more about its rich history.
3. Salt Marshes
The salt marshes are another attraction worth visiting in Mar Lodj. The island's salt ponds are ideal for bird watching and photography, and are an excellent place to experience the stunning sunset or sunrise.
4. Beaches
Mar Lodj's beautiful beaches are perfect for those who want to relax, sunbathe, and enjoy the sea breeze. The beaches offer a range of activities such as swimming, snorkeling, and kayaking.
5. Ngueniene Forest
Not far from Mar Lodj Island, Ngueniene Forest is a nature reserve that is home to various wildlife, including Warthogs and the Green Monkey. Tourists can explore the forest's hiking trails, admire the scenery and wildlife, and take a guided tour to learn more about the forest's history.
6. Explore Traditional Art and Culture
Mar Lodj Island's town is home to traditional Senegalese music and dance as well as beautiful handicrafts. Visitors can explore traditional art and culture by touring art galleries, watching traditional dance performances, and learning how to make traditional crafts.
